Spread the hot charcoal all over the bottom of your pit and place a few logs over it. I used a bicycle rim that is slightly smaller than my lid - or you can just use the lid you plan on using. If you notice your logs starting to actually burn with an open flame, this will be a clue that your fire is getting TOO hot. True barbecue comes from long, slow cooking on low heat. A barbecue grill isn't often expensive, but doesn't quite hold the smoke in to make really good smoked meat. Cook surface + fuel size ( four or five inches for logs, two or three inches for charcoal ) + an inch of drainage rocks + six inches = pit depth.
